In the bulk liquid terminal industry, managing the volatility of fuels is both an economic and a safety imperative. Traditional fixed-roof tanks often suffer from significant "breathing losses," where temperature fluctuations cause liquid fuel to transition into gas and escape into the atmosphere. The External Floating Roof for Welded Stainless Steel Fuel Storage Tanks is a premier engineering solution designed to mitigate these challenges. This system dramatically reduces evaporation losses and enhances safety by eliminating the vapor space above the liquid, providing a buoyant deck that maintains constant contact with the fuel. When paired with a welded stainless steel shell and shielded by an Aluminum Dome Roof, it represents the highest standard of modern fuel containment.
The primary driver of fuel loss in large-scale storage is the headspace—the volume of air and vapor that exists between the liquid surface and a fixed roof. As the tank is filled or as ambient temperatures rise, this vapor is pushed out of vents, resulting in lost revenue and environmental damage. The external floating roof addresses this by resting directly on the fuel.
As the fuel level rises or falls, the floating roof moves in tandem, ensuring that there is never an open surface for evaporation to occur. The efficiency of this system is significantly enhanced by the use of welded stainless steel for the tank shell. Unlike carbon steel, which can develop rust and scale that creates friction for the roof seals, stainless steel maintains a smooth, consistent internal surface. This allows the perimeter seals of the floating roof to maintain a gas-tight contact throughout the entire vertical range of the tank. This precision is what allows the system to dramatically reduce evaporation losses, keeping the fuel in its liquid state.
While the floating roof manages the internal vapor-air interface, the tank requires a robust external shield to protect the system from environmental factors. The Aluminum Dome Roof has become the industry standard for this secondary protection. The geodesic dome provides a clear-span, weather-tight cover that protects the internal floating roof from rain, snow, and wind-driven debris, all of which could otherwise compromise the roof's buoyancy or damage the seals.
A decisive advantage of the Aluminum Dome Roof is its self-supporting design. Traditional roofs require internal support columns that must penetrate the floating roof, creating dozens of potential leak paths where vapors can escape. By utilizing a column-free aluminum dome, the interior of the welded stainless steel tank remains completely unobstructed. This allows the floating roof to provide a seamless, 100% effective vapor barrier across the entire surface. Furthermore, by eliminating the vapor space above the liquid, the system removes the risk of explosive gas accumulation, while the aluminum dome acts as a natural protective shield, thereby enhancing site safety.
The combination of welded stainless steel and an aluminum dome offers a solution with unmatched longevity. Welded stainless steel is inherently resistant to the corrosive components often found in modern fuels and does not require internal linings that can peel and contaminate the fuel. Similarly, the Aluminum Dome Roof is naturally resistant to atmospheric corrosion and does not require periodic sandblasting or repainting.
This integrated system also facilitates safer and more efficient inspections. The structural simplicity of the column-free dome allows technicians to monitor the condition of the seals and the movement of the floating roof without navigating internal obstacles. This reliability ensures that fuel terminals can maintain high operational uptime while meeting the strictest environmental and safety regulations.
